Illuminating Interiors: A Guide to Effective Interior Lighting Design

Creating a welcoming and stylish interior space depends heavily on effective lighting design. Supplementing simply providing visibility, well-planned lighting can enhance the atmosphere of a room, highlight architectural features, and foster a sense of balance.

  • To attain optimal interior lighting, consider the function of each space. For example task lighting for kitchens and work areas, ambient lighting for general illumination, and accent lighting to spotlight specific elements.
  • Play with different types of lamps to match the style of your decor. Contemporary fixtures can create a sleek and refined feel, while vintage options add personality.
  • Don't forget to consider the location of your lighting. Strategically placed lights can reshape the perception of a room, making it appear more spacious.

Designing a Welcoming Living Room: Interior Lighting Essentials

To enhance your living room into a truly inviting space, consider the influence of interior lighting. A well-planned lighting scheme can showcase your home's best features and generate a warm and welcoming atmosphere. Combine different types of lighting – such as overhead fixtures, table lamps, and accent lights – to create a multi-faceted ambiance that responds to your needs throughout the day.

  • Embrace warm-toned light bulbs to induce a relaxing and cozy feeling in the evenings.
  • Flood reading nooks with task lighting to enable focused activities.
  • Strategically place accent lights to highlight artwork, architectural details, or decorative elements.

Interior Lighting Trends for Modern and Contemporary Homes

Modern and contemporary homes are increasingly embracing brightness solutions that go beyond mere functionality. Integrated lighting technologies are seamlessly integrated into architectural designs, creating dynamic atmospheres. From sleek, minimalist fixtures to statement chandeliers with an industrial edge, the options are diverse.

A key trend is the use of warm LED lights, offering energy efficiency and a range of color temperatures to enhance various moods. Highlighting lighting with strategically placed spots adds depth and visual interest, while adjustable options allow for personalized lighting schemes throughout the day.

Incorporating natural light through large windows and skylights remains a cornerstone element, further blurring the lines between indoors and out. Landscape lighting extensions the outdoor spaces, creating an inviting mood.

These trends reflect a growing awareness for how brightness can shape our experience of space, promoting both functionality and aesthetic appeal.
